1) Under the Real Estate Brokerage Agreement (hereinafter referred to as the "Agreement"), the Broker undertakes to use its best efforts to identify and introduce a Third Party to the Client for the purpose of negotiating and concluding a legal transaction involving the transfer or establishment of rights in or relating to a specific property, including, but not limited to: sale and purchase; lease; tenancy; exchange; or any other disposition of real estate. The Client undertakes to pay the agreed Brokerage Commission (hereinafter referred to as the "Commission") if such legal transaction is concluded. For the purposes of these General Terms and Conditions, a legal transaction shall also be deemed concluded upon execution of a Preliminary Agreement, whereby the contracting parties undertake to conclude the principal agreement concerning the transfer or establishment of rights in or relating to the property.
2) The Agreement shall be concluded in writing for a fixed term.
3) Unless expressly agreed otherwise by the contracting parties, the Agreement shall remain in force for a period of twelve (12) months from the date of its execution.
4) The Broker may transfer the performance of the Brokerage Agreement to another licensed real estate broker (the "Partner Broker") with whom the Broker has entered into a business cooperation agreement, provided that such transfer has been expressly agreed between the Broker and the Client. The Partner Broker may perform all contractual obligations relating to the property in the name and on behalf of the Broker, whether within the Republic of Croatia or abroad.
Notwithstanding such transfer, the Broker shall remain solely liable to the Client for the due performance of all obligations arising from the Agreement.
The Client shall pay the Brokerage Commission exclusively to: DALMAT NEKRETNINE Real Estate Agency, OIB: 69727713007.
1) A Brokerage Agreement concluded for a fixed term shall terminate upon expiry of the period for which it was concluded if the transaction for which brokerage services were provided has not been concluded within that period, or earlier upon termination by either contracting party.
2) Where termination of the Brokerage Agreement by the Client would be contrary to the principle of good faith and fair dealing or intended to deprive the Broker of its entitlement to the Brokerage Commission, the Broker shall be entitled to compensation for damages in an amount equal to the agreed Brokerage Commission.
3) The Client shall reimburse the Broker for all expenses expressly agreed to be borne separately by the Client.
4) If, after termination of the Brokerage Agreement, the Client concludes a legal transaction that is the direct consequence of the Broker's activities performed before termination of the Agreement, the Client shall pay the Broker the Brokerage Commission in full, irrespective of whether the transaction is concluded directly with the Third Party or through any person affiliated with the Third Party.
1) By entering into an Exclusive Brokerage Agreement, the Client undertakes not to appoint any other real estate broker in respect of the brokered transaction and shall neither sell nor otherwise market the property independently or through any third party without the Broker's involvement.
2) If, during the term of the Exclusive Brokerage Agreement, the Client concludes the intended legal transaction independently or through another broker, despite having granted the Broker an exclusive mandate, the Client shall pay the Broker the agreed Brokerage Commission together with any actual additional expenses incurred during the provision of brokerage services, regardless of whether the legal transaction was concluded directly or through persons affiliated with the Client.
3) Before entering into an Exclusive Brokerage Agreement, the Broker shall specifically inform the Client of the meaning and legal consequences of the exclusivity clause referred to in the preceding paragraph.
4) An Exclusive Brokerage Agreement concluded for a fixed term shall terminate upon expiry of the agreed term if the brokered legal transaction has not been concluded during that period.
5) Where an Exclusive Brokerage Agreement expires due to the reason stated in the preceding paragraph, the Client shall reimburse the Broker for all expenses expressly agreed to be paid separately by the Client.
6) If, following termination of the Exclusive Brokerage Agreement, the Client concludes a legal transaction that is the consequence of the Broker's activities performed before termination of the Agreement, the Client shall remain liable to pay the Brokerage Commission in full, irrespective of whether the transaction is concluded directly with the Third Party or through persons affiliated with the Third Party.
7) If the Client terminates the Exclusive Brokerage Agreement before the expiry of the agreed term, the Client shall compensate the Broker for any damage resulting from such termination.
8) For the purposes of the preceding paragraph, the amount of such damages shall be 3% (three per cent) of the asking price of the property, or such other amount as may be stipulated in the Exclusive Brokerage Agreement, increased by the applicable Value Added Tax (VAT).
The obligation to compensate the Broker shall become due on the date the Client terminates the Exclusive Brokerage Agreement.

1) The amount of the Brokerage Commission shall be determined by the Brokerage Agreement in accordance with the Broker's applicable Price List. The agreed Brokerage Commission includes all standard brokerage services specified in Section VI of these General Terms and Conditions and in the Broker's applicable Price List.
2) Charges for additional services that do not form part of the Broker's ordinary brokerage activities may be imposed only where such services have been expressly agreed with the Client in advance.
The agreement shall specify: the nature of the additional service; a description of the service; the amount of the charge or the method by which it shall be calculated; and the party responsible for payment.
3) Where additional services are charged on an hourly basis, the brokerage hourly rate shall amount to EUR 100.00 (one hundred euros). The Broker shall also be entitled to reimbursement of any separately agreed actual expenses incurred in providing such services.
4) Value Added Tax (VAT) shall be charged on all brokerage commissions and other fees in accordance with applicable legislation.
5) The Broker may charge a brokerage commission to both the Client and the Third Party in respect of the same property, provided that a separate Brokerage Agreement has been concluded with each party. The Broker shall not charge a brokerage commission to a purchaser, tenant, lessee or other acquiring party who has not entered into a Brokerage Agreement with the Broker.
6) Where the Broker has concluded Brokerage Agreements with two Clients concerning the same property and both agreements provide that each Client shall pay a Brokerage Commission, the aggregate commission payable by both Clients shall not exceed the maximum brokerage commission prescribed by the Broker's applicable Price List in force on the date those Brokerage Agreements were concluded.
7) Where the Broker has concluded Brokerage Agreements with two Clients concerning the same property but only one Client has undertaken to pay the Brokerage Commission, the Broker may charge that Client no more than one-half of the maximum brokerage commission prescribed by the applicable Price List in force at the time the Brokerage Agreement was concluded.
8) Before concluding the Brokerage Agreement, the Broker shall inform the contracting parties in writing of: the individual Brokerage Commission payable by each party; and the aggregate Brokerage Commission payable in relation to the transaction.
9) Where the brokered legal transaction includes the execution of a Preliminary Agreement under which the Client and the Third Party undertake to conclude a final agreement relating to the property, and such Preliminary Agreement provides for payment of a deposit and/or part of the purchase price before execution of the final Purchase Agreement, the Client shall pay the Brokerage Commission in two equal instalments: the first instalment shall become due upon payment of the deposit and/or part of the agreed purchase price; the second instalment shall become due upon execution of the final Purchase Agreement or upon expiry of the contractual deadline for its execution.
10) Where the Preliminary Agreement does not provide for payment of a deposit or any part of the purchase price before execution of the final Purchase Agreement, the Brokerage Commission shall become payable on the date the agreed purchase price is paid in full or upon expiry of the contractual deadline for payment provided in the Preliminary Agreement or the final Purchase Agreement.
11) Where the legal transaction consists solely of the execution of a final Purchase Agreement and the purchase price is payable by instalments or includes payment of a deposit, the Brokerage Commission shall be payable in two equal instalments: the first instalment upon payment of the deposit and/or first instalment of the purchase price; the second instalment upon payment of the remaining purchase price in full or upon expiry of the contractual payment deadline.
12) Where the Purchase Agreement provides for payment of the purchase price in a single lump sum, the Brokerage Commission shall become payable on the date the purchase price is paid in full or upon expiry of the contractual deadline for payment.
13) Where the brokered legal transaction includes the execution of a Preliminary Agreement relating to the property that is the subject of the brokerage services, any subsequent withdrawal by either the Client or the Third Party from the Preliminary Agreement, or any failure by either party to perform the obligations arising from the concluded agreement, shall not affect the Client's obligation to pay the Brokerage Commission in the amount and in the manner stipulated by these General Terms and Conditions and the Brokerage Agreement.
14) The Client shall also be obliged to pay the Brokerage Commission where the Client concludes, with a Third Party introduced by the Broker, a legal transaction different from the one originally contemplated, provided that such transaction achieves substantially the same commercial purpose or concerns the property that was the subject of the brokerage services.
15) The Broker shall be deemed to have successfully introduced the Client to a Third Party where the Broker has: personally accompanied or directed the Client to inspect the property; organized a meeting between the Client and the Third Party for the purpose of negotiating the intended legal transaction; provided the Client with the name, company name, telephone number, fax number or e-mail address of the Third Party authorized to conclude the legal transaction; disclosed the precise location of the property; in any other manner enabled the Client and the Third Party to commence negotiations or conclude the legal transaction.
16) The introduction of the Client to a Third Party does not necessarily require a physical inspection of the property. General advertising of the property, without establishing a specific connection between the Client and the Third Party, shall not in itself constitute an introduction giving rise to the Broker's entitlement to the Brokerage Commission. Such introduction may be evidenced by the Broker's business records, CRM records, e-mail correspondence, telephone records, written offers or any other business documentation.
17) Following termination of the Brokerage Agreement, the Broker shall remain entitled to the Brokerage Commission where the Client concludes a legal transaction with the Third Party, or with any person affiliated with the Third Party, if such transaction is the direct consequence of the Broker's activities performed before termination of the Brokerage Agreement.
18) Where the Client withdraws from the brokered transaction during negotiations or before conclusion of the legal transaction, such withdrawal shall not in itself create an obligation to pay the Brokerage Commission in full unless the Broker's entitlement to the Commission has already arisen under the Brokerage Agreement, these General Terms and Conditions and the applicable legislation.
Where the Client has failed to act in good faith, the Broker shall be entitled to compensation for damages together with reimbursement of all expenses incurred, in accordance with applicable legislation and these General Terms and Conditions.
19) The Broker shall also be entitled to the Brokerage Commission where the brokered legal transaction is concluded by: the Client's spouse or cohabiting partner; the Client's descendants or parents; a company, institution or other legal entity established by, owned by, managed by or legally represented by the Client, the Client's spouse or cohabiting partner, descendants or parents, or with which any of them maintains an employment or contractual relationship, provided that such person or entity concludes the brokered legal transaction with the person introduced by the Broker.
20) The Broker shall likewise remain entitled to the Brokerage Commission where the Client transfers ownership of, or otherwise disposes of, the property that is the subject of the brokerage services in favour of any person referred to in the preceding paragraph, and that person subsequently concludes either the brokered legal transaction or another transaction having substantially the same commercial purpose with the Third Party or with a person affiliated with the Third Party.
1) The Broker's current Price List of Brokerage Fees forms an integral part of these General Terms and Conditions and every Brokerage Agreement.
The applicable version shall be the version in force on the date the Brokerage Agreement is concluded.
2) The applicable Price List shall specify: the Brokerage Commission; the minimum Brokerage Commission; the person or persons liable for payment of the Brokerage Commission; the services included within the Brokerage Commission; the maximum aggregate Brokerage Commission where commissions are payable by both contracting parties; and the rules governing additional services and reimbursable expenses.
3) The Price List shall be presented to the Client before the Brokerage Agreement is executed and shall be signed by both the Broker and the Client, or by the Third Party where such Third Party enters into a separate Brokerage Agreement with the Broker.
4) The Broker shall not charge a Brokerage Commission to any purchaser, tenant, lessee or other acquiring party who has not entered into a separate Brokerage Agreement with the Broker.
1) The Broker shall not advertise any property unless a Brokerage Agreement has first been concluded with the property owner or another duly authorized Client.
2) Where the Broker advertises a property pursuant to a Brokerage Agreement, the Broker shall not make inspection of that property conditional upon the prospective purchaser or other interested party first entering into a Brokerage Agreement.
3) Each inspection of a property arranged through the Broker shall be evidenced by the signing of a Property Viewing Confirmation, whereby the Broker or the Agent confirms to the Client that the property has been shown to a Third Party.
4) A Property Viewing Confirmation shall not constitute a Brokerage Agreement and shall not contain any provision obliging the Third Party to pay a Brokerage Commission.
